The Scarecrow Cabernet Sauvignon 2013 is produced entirely from grapes grown in the vineyard blocks of the historic J.J. Cohn Estate in the Rutherford AVA, located within California's renowned Napa Valley. 

Harvested entirely by hand from September 16 to October 9, 2013 and after a slow four-week fermentation, the wine was matured in new French Oak barrels for 22 months prior to bottling in late July 2015. 

The 2013 vintage in California has been hailed as one of the greatest by winemakers, producing some exceptional and historic examples of Cabernet Sauvignon.
